Searched refs:parent_path (Results 1 – 7 of 7) sorted by relevance
| /linux/arch/powerpc/platforms/pseries/ |
| H A D | of_helpers.c | 21 char *parent_path = "/"; in pseries_of_derive_parent() local 32 parent_path = kstrndup(path, tail - path, GFP_KERNEL); in pseries_of_derive_parent() 33 if (!parent_path) in pseries_of_derive_parent() 36 parent = of_find_node_by_path(parent_path); in pseries_of_derive_parent() 37 if (strcmp(parent_path, "/")) in pseries_of_derive_parent() 38 kfree(parent_path); in pseries_of_derive_parent()
|
| /linux/kernel/ |
| H A D | audit_watch.c | 407 struct path parent_path; in audit_add_watch() local 420 ret = audit_get_nd(watch, &parent_path); in audit_add_watch() 431 parent = audit_find_parent(d_backing_inode(parent_path.dentry)); in audit_add_watch() 433 parent = audit_init_parent(&parent_path); in audit_add_watch() 445 path_put(&parent_path); in audit_add_watch()
|
| /linux/drivers/acpi/acpica/ |
| H A D | dbcmds.c | 760 char *parent_path; in acpi_db_device_resources() local 765 parent_path = acpi_ns_get_normalized_pathname(node, TRUE); in acpi_db_device_resources() 766 if (!parent_path) { in acpi_db_device_resources() 785 acpi_os_printf("\nDevice: %s\n", parent_path); in acpi_db_device_resources() 961 ACPI_FREE(parent_path); in acpi_db_device_resources()
|
| /linux/tools/cgroup/ |
| H A D | iocost_monitor.py | 72 def walk(self, blkcg, q_id, parent_path): argument 78 path = parent_path + '/' + name if parent_path else name
|
| /linux/fs/smb/server/ |
| H A D | vfs.c | 1146 struct path parent_path; in __ksmbd_vfs_kern_path() local 1158 parent_path = share_conf->vfs_path; in __ksmbd_vfs_kern_path() 1159 path_get(&parent_path); in __ksmbd_vfs_kern_path() 1161 while (d_can_lookup(parent_path.dentry)) { in __ksmbd_vfs_kern_path() 1170 err = ksmbd_vfs_lookup_in_dir(&parent_path, filename, in __ksmbd_vfs_kern_path() 1173 path_put(&parent_path); in __ksmbd_vfs_kern_path() 1186 &parent_path); in __ksmbd_vfs_kern_path() 1195 path_put(&parent_path); in __ksmbd_vfs_kern_path()
|
| /linux/fs/ |
| H A D | namei.c | 2957 struct path parent_path __free(path_put) = {}; in __start_removing_path() 2962 error = filename_parentat(dfd, name, 0, &parent_path, &last, &type); in __start_removing_path() 2968 error = mnt_want_write(parent_path.mnt); in __start_removing_path() 2969 d = start_dirop(parent_path.dentry, &last, 0); in __start_removing_path() 2974 path->dentry = no_free_ptr(parent_path.dentry); in __start_removing_path() 2975 path->mnt = no_free_ptr(parent_path.mnt); in __start_removing_path() 2983 mnt_drop_write(parent_path.mnt); in __start_removing_path() 3002 struct path parent_path __free(path_put) = {}; in kern_path_parent() 3008 error = filename_parentat(AT_FDCWD, filename, 0, &parent_path, &last, &type); in kern_path_parent() 3014 d = lookup_noperm_unlocked(&last, parent_path.dentry); in kern_path_parent() [all …]
|
| /linux/drivers/of/ |
| H A D | unittest.c | 1662 const char *parent_path; member 1671 .parent_path = "/testcase-data/interrupts/intc0", 1677 .parent_path = "/testcase-data/interrupts/intc1", 1683 .parent_path = "/testcase-data/interrupts/intc2", 1689 .parent_path = "/testcase-data/interrupts/intc2", 1728 expected_parent_np = of_find_node_by_path(expected_item->parent_path); in of_unittest_parse_interrupt_map() 1731 expected_item->parent_path)) { in of_unittest_parse_interrupt_map()
|